A major mining operation in Peru was facing challenges in one of its material handling systems. The conveyor belt had a protection device installed at the tail pulley, but its design did not effectively prevent the entrapment of objects between the belt and the pulley, which could cause severe damage to the system. In addition to failing to meet CEMA standards, the equipment’s structure caused accelerated wear on the inner cover of the belt, reducing its service life and directly impacting the reliability of the conveyor. This situation also made operation and maintenance tasks more complex, increasing downtime and associated costs.
